Key Market Insights
Global Jasmine Rice Market is projected to grow from USD 28.7 Billion in 2025 to USD 49.5 Billion by 2035, reflecting a compound annual growth rate of 5.4% from 2026 through 2035. This market encompasses the production, distribution, and consumption of jasmine rice, a long-grain variety known for its aromatic fragrance and slightly sticky texture when cooked. The market's expansion is primarily driven by rising global demand for premium, aromatic rice varieties, growing consumer awareness of its health benefits such as being naturally gluten-free, and increasing disposable incomes in emerging economies. The convenience offered by various packaging options and wider distribution channels further fuels this growth. However, market restraints include price volatility due to weather dependency in key producing regions and competition from other rice varieties.

A key trend observed is the growing popularity of organic and sustainably sourced jasmine rice, driven by health-conscious consumers and environmental concerns. The market also sees an increasing demand for ready-to-eat and microwavable jasmine rice products, catering to busy urban lifestyles. Opportunities abound in product diversification, such as jasmine rice flour and snack applications, and expanding into untapped geographical markets. Asia Pacific dominates the jasmine rice market due to its deep cultural integration of rice consumption, large producing countries like Thailand and Vietnam, and high domestic demand.
The Middle East and Africa is identified as the fastest growing region, propelled by increasing urbanization, evolving dietary preferences towards premium food products, and a growing expatriate population familiar with jasmine rice. Key players like Tdat International, Aditya Birla Group, Thaitex Co Ltd, Suwanket Farm, and Vietnam Southern Food Corporation are focusing on strategic initiatives such as expanding their production capacities, improving supply chain efficiencies, and investing in branding and marketing to capture a larger market share. Product innovation and geographical expansion are central to their competitive strategies in this dynamic market.

Global Jasmine Rice Market Regulatory and Policy Environment Analysis
The Global Jasmine Rice market operates within a multifaceted regulatory framework. International trade policies including tariffs and non-tariff barriers significantly influence market access and pricing dynamics. Importing nations enforce stringent food safety standards, encompassing sanitary and phytosanitary measures and maximum residue limits for pesticides and contaminants. Varied labeling requirements across regions mandate disclosure of origin, nutritional information, and sometimes specific cultivation practices. Geographical indications protect premium jasmine rice varieties, adding intellectual property considerations to market entry. Emerging sustainability regulations increasingly impact supply chain management, driving demand for environmentally friendly and ethically sourced production. Additionally, agricultural subsidies in major producing countries shape global supply and competitiveness.

Dominant Region
Asia Pacific · 68.2% share
Asia Pacific stands as the dominant region in the global jasmine rice market, commanding a substantial 68.2% market share. This dominance is deeply rooted in the region's historical and cultural affinity for rice, particularly premium varieties like jasmine. Major producing countries such as Thailand and Vietnam are located within Asia Pacific, benefitting from ideal climatic conditions and extensive agricultural infrastructure. Consumer demand is consistently high across the region driven by traditional cuisines and the perceived quality and aromatic properties of jasmine rice. Furthermore efficient supply chains and well established trade networks within Asia Pacific facilitate easy distribution and accessibility of jasmine rice contributing significantly to its leading position. This strong domestic production and robust regional consumption underpin Asia Pacific's unparalleled dominance.

Impact of Geopolitical and Macroeconomic Factors
Geopolitical tensions in Southeast Asia disrupt supply chains for jasmine rice, impacting logistics and trade routes. Climate change, particularly droughts and floods, severely affects paddy yields in major producing nations like Thailand and Vietnam, creating price volatility and food security concerns. Export restrictions or trade disputes among key players could further destabilize the market.
Macroeconomic factors include fluctuating currency exchange rates, influencing export competitiveness and import costs. Rising fertilizer and fuel prices inflate production expenses, pressuring farmer profitability and potentially increasing consumer prices. Global inflation and shifting consumer preferences towards cheaper rice varieties or other staples also influence demand and market dynamics.
